Output 8c89fc56c639a76146fdd3aa17d0957d78756cacc52cee915e8e38e5b88a92ec:0

value
125772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04f0e219211fd5d2acf4a1bdcdb9b22edc4e49b3 OP_EQUAL
address
3299CAkb9ctf3u2zwUsG37GdJpp7y5pgK8
transaction
8c89fc56c639a76146fdd3aa17d0957d78756cacc52cee915e8e38e5b88a92ec
confirmations
430593
spent
true